legongju.com
我们一直在努力
2024-12-25 16:38 | 星期三

android sepolicy能保护哪些数据

Android的SELinux(Security-Enhanced Linux)是一种内核安全模块,用于实施强制访问控制(MAC)策略,从而保护系统免受恶意攻击和数据泄露。以下是SELinux能保护哪些数据的相关信息:

SELinux能保护哪些数据

  • 系统文件:防止未经授权的应用程序读取或修改系统关键文件。
  • 网络通信:控制应用程序的网络访问权限,防止数据泄露。
  • 应用程序数据:通过定义细粒度的权限,保护应用程序的私有数据不被其他应用程序访问。
  • 系统属性:限制应用程序对系统设置和配置的访问。

SELinux的工作模式和默认行为

  • 工作模式:SELinux可以以宽容模式(记录违规事件但不强制执行)或强制模式(记录并强制执行违规事件)运行。
  • 默认行为:SELinux按照默认拒绝的原则运行,即任何未经明确允许的行为都会被拒绝。

SELinux如何通过安全上下文和策略控制访问

  • 安全上下文:是Android系统中标识和控制进程、应用程序、服务和资源的基本单位。每个组件都有一个唯一的安全上下文,包含标签、权限和访问控制策略。
  • 安全策略:定义了进程的权限范围、访问路径、操作对象等,从而有效地防止恶意应用程序的攻击。

通过这些机制,SELinux能够显著提高Android系统的安全性,保护用户数据和系统资源免受未授权访问和潜在的安全威胁。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/44699.html

相关推荐

  • Android开发中如何优化应用的性能

    Android开发中如何优化应用的性能

    在Android开发中,优化应用性能是一个重要的任务,可以提高用户体验和减少资源消耗。以下是一些建议来帮助您优化应用性能: 使用高效的布局:尽量使用Constraint...

  • android aaudio能做音频效果处理吗

    android aaudio能做音频效果处理吗

    AAudio是Android平台上的一种低级音频API,它提供了对音频数据的低延迟访问和高性能处理能力。然而,AAudio本身并不直接提供高级的音频效果处理功能,如混响、均...

  • android aaudio支持音频录制吗

    android aaudio支持音频录制吗

    Android AAudio支持音频录制。AAudio是Android 10中引入的一种新的音频API,旨在提供低延迟、高保真度的音频体验。尽管AAudio的设计初衷是为了提供高质量的音频播...

  • android viewstub如何提升用户体验

    android viewstub如何提升用户体验

    Android ViewStub 是一个轻量级的视图,它在初始化时会延迟加载,从而提升应用程序的启动速度和性能。要使用 ViewStub 提升用户体验,请遵循以下步骤: 在布局文...

  • android sepolicy怎样提高系统安全

    android sepolicy怎样提高系统安全

    Android的SELinux(Security-Enhanced Linux)是一种内核安全模块,提供了强制访问控制(MAC),从而限制了进程的权限,防止恶意应用程序获取系统关键信息或执行...

  • android sepolicy如何定制规则

    android sepolicy如何定制规则

    Android的SEPolicy(Security Enhancement Policy)是Android系统中用于定义应用程序权限和访问控制的安全策略。定制SEPolicy规则通常涉及修改Android系统的源代...

  • android sepolicy怎样检查权限违规

    android sepolicy怎样检查权限违规

    Android的SELinux(Security-Enhanced Linux)是一种内核安全模块,它提供了访问控制安全策略。要检查Android设备上的权限违规,您可以使用以下方法: 使用adb命...

  • android sepolicy如何设置默认策略

    android sepolicy如何设置默认策略

    在Android系统中,SELinux(Security-Enhanced Linux)是一种内核安全模块,提供了访问控制安全策略。要设置默认策略,您需要编辑SELinux的配置文件。以下是如何...